Due to our increasing demand for Java experts, our office in Novi Sad is looking for an:
Java Developer
About us:
Our culture is based on knowledge, agility, quality and transparency. That is why all developers are encouraged to spend 20% of their time on any project they want. In addition to a friendly working environment with flat hierarchies, we offer codecentric developers the opportunity to spend their education budget on whatever they think is best (conferences, workshops, Internet of Things projects…). As our colleagues you have an opportunity to exchange ideas with more than 400 colleagues located in 4 countries. Codecentric is known as a leader when it comes to knowledge sharing. We are proud to be organizers of Coding Serbia conference and meetup and we are also giving our support to other IT communities in Novi Sad and Serbia.
As a Java developer you:
- Think that development skills are valued more than the length of your professional experience
- Value code that is both readable and maintainable
- See writing automated tests as a benefit, not a chore
- Are willing to contribute as a full-stack developer working on everything through development all the way to deployment of your code
- Care about your craft, are aware of new technologies and you are keen to use them when appropriate
- Want a place to grow, to learn, and to make a difference
As a company we expect that you have:
- Solid Java development knowledge regardless of a framework
- A technical mindset with good understanding of algorithms, data structures and design patterns
- Experience designing and implementing RESTful web services
- Knowledge of Agile development practices
The extra bits:
- Knowledge and experience working with Linux
- Exposure to other JVM based languages such as Groovy or Scala
- Experience in building microservices
- Some experience in DevOps tech such as Puppet, Ansible or Chef
- Some experience with NoSql ecosystem (e.g. Mongo, Hadoop, Elasticsearch, Neo4J)
Deadline for applications: 20.07.2016.